Itinerary Breakdown

London: Stonehenge and Bath Full-Day Tour - Itinerary Breakdown

With a well-structured itinerary, the London: Stonehenge and Bath Full-Day Tour ensures travelers make the most of their time at these remarkable sites.

The journey kicks off at Earls Court Station, with a comfortable luxury coach ride to Stonehenge, which takes about two hours. Once there, participants enjoy a total of two hours, including a generous 90 minutes for exploration.

After soaking in the ancient atmosphere, the tour heads to Bath for a delightful three-hour self-guided experience. Travelers can visit iconic landmarks like Bath Abbey and the Royal Crescent, with an option to explore the Roman Baths.

Important Travel Information

London: Stonehenge and Bath Full-Day Tour - Important Travel Information

Travelers should be aware that all passengers must board at Earls Court Station by 9:00 AM for a prompt departure, especially if they’ve booked last-minute. Arriving early ensures a smooth start to the tour.

Here are a few important travel details to keep in mind:

  • The journey to Stonehenge takes about 2 hours each way, so plan accordingly.

  • Audioguides at Stonehenge may vary in availability, so downloading the guide beforehand is recommended.

  • If you wish to arrange a pickup from alternate locations, contact the provider 48 hours in advance.

With these tips, travelers can maximize their experience and enjoy both Stonehenge and Bath without a hitch.
